Algeria is a North African country known for its diverse cultural heritage that has been influenced by various civilizations throughout history. The country's culture is a blend of Arab, Berber, and French influences, which can be seen in its language, cuisine, music, and traditions. One of the most notable aspects of Algerian culture is its cuisine, which is a flavorful mix of Mediterranean and African flavors. Popular Algerian dishes include couscous, tajine, and mechoui, which are often enjoyed with mint tea or strong coffee. Music and dance also play a significant role in Algerian culture, with traditional music styles like Raï and Chaâbi being popular among the population. Traditional dances like the Ahidous and the Kabyle dance are also an important part of Algerian cultural events and celebrations.
